Responsibility
- Lead time studies and process mapping to identify bottlenecks and waste in production lines.
- Develop standardized work, work instructions, and operator balance to optimize throughput.
- Conduct time and motion studies; balance lines and estimate capacity to meet demand.
- Drive Lean manufacturing initiatives (5S, Kaizen events) to reduce lead times and scrap.
- Collaborate with Production, Quality, and Supply Chain to implement continuous improvement projects.
- Analyze production data (OEE, yield, scrap) and prepare actionable reports for management.
- Support design for manufacturability (DFM) and instrument process changes using CAD/BOM data.
Qualification
- Bachelor’s degree in Industrial Engineering or related field (Master’s preferred).
- 3+ years of experience in manufacturing/industrial engineering roles.
- Strong knowledge of Lean tools (5S, Kaizen, SMED, Kanban) and line balancing.
- Proficient in data analysis with Excel; experience with Minitab, Power BI, or SQL is a plus.
- Experience with time studies, capacity planning, and process optimization.
- Excellent problem-solving, communication, and cross-functional collaboration skills.
- Ability to read blueprints and process drawings; CAD experience is a plus.
